What does it mean to press a drink?

Quite simply, the vodka press is a shot of vodka with both club soda and lemon-lime soda. It's made just like the raspberry press, but with clear vodka. The word "press" in the name may seem to indicate that you'll be pressing something with a muddler, but that is not the case.

What is pressed in bartending?

The name took inspiration from a whiskey drink called “Presbyterian.” Plus, any drink with an equal quantity of 7Up and soda water is called “press.”

What does vodka pressed mean?

“Press” is a common bar term referring to equal parts lemon-lime soda (such as 7up or Sprite) and Club Soda. This duo combined with vodka served over ice will produce a refreshing Vodka Press.

What does it mean when a drink is perfect?

When the word “perfect” comes before the name of a classic, usually a Manhattan or a Martini, this means the vermouth in the drink has been split 50-50 sweet and dry. In other words, 50 percent of the called-for vermouth is sweet; and the remaining 50 percent is dry.

Why is cold press juicer called masticating juicer?

Machines and tools built to aid in cold-press juicing are also called masticating juicers, because they use hydraulic power to effectively chew and crush the juice out of otherwise fibrous plants. Cold-pressing takes longer and produces less juice. Though, in theory, the juice created is richer in nutritional content. 10Best.

How does centrifugal presser work?

Centrifugal pressers kickstart the oxidation process by exposing newly liquid juice to air as it is forced through spinning blades. Vitamins B and C, as well as antioxidizing phenolic compounds, are particularly sensitive to degradation when forced into contact with air.

Do cold press juicers still work?

Cold-press juicers still expose juice to air. They just aren’t pumping air into newly liquid juice. Hydraulic mastication of vegetables is a slower, less efficient process. But it’s one that does preserve more of what we find advantageous within plenty of fruits and vegetables.
